It may not relate but... I only drive my vette on weekends. I was starting to have problems with my lights not popping up/not coming on. Someone suggested since I drive the car infrequently the initial pop up/turn on sequence takes a lot of power to do so and drains the battery. I turned off my Twilight Sentinel, the gizmo that automatically turns on the lights at dusk/turns them off at daylight, and have only used the stalk switch since. I have not had a problem since then. As an added benefit the lights don't pop up inside the garage every time I start the car. Hope this helps. :confused:
